I admit it, I do have the sappy gene. Last Wednesday, my mom, sister and I went to an absolutely knee weakening concert in the most unusual of places, the parking lot in Promenade at Greenhills.

It was a free concert by the Philippine Philharmonic Orchestra, and for a few hours, we just lost ourselves in the notes. I cannot presume to know the pieces that were played as I am not a devotee, but what I heard, I liked.

We giggled when the orchestra played a few songs from The Sound of Music because we were desperately trying to keep our mom from singing along. When they played a medley of Parokya ni Edgar songs, it only endeared the group to us more.

We had so much fun, we hardly noticed the rain until the downpour.

We left soaked and shivering and went off to dinner satiated, and cannot wait for the next installment.

It capped off a stressful, yet fulfilling day that until now has me smiling a little.

I hope we catch the next one when it happens.
